Where AI meets education

The technology of democratizing access to knowledge and charting a more equitable digital future should begin where it is needed the most, in Africa

As artificial intelligence redefines the frontiers of global innovation, its integration into the education systems presents both a challenge and an opportunity — especially for countries in the Global South. In Africa, where digital divides and educational disparities persist, AI education offers a promising pathway toward a more equitable future.

This vision was powerfully reinforced at the World Artificial Intelligence Conference 2025, held in Shanghai from July 26 to 28, where leaders, scholars and innovators from across the world gathered to explore AI's potential to bridge global divides. A key theme of the conference was the inclusive growth of AI — particularly how it can empower marginalized communities and enhance access to education across continents. WAIC 2025 underscored a critical truth — unless AI becomes a tool for global equity, it risks becoming another driver of inequality.

While much of the global AI conversation focuses on automation, job displacement and regulatory frameworks in the Global North, the educational potential of AI in the Global South deserves far more attention. In regions where there are teacher shortages, outdated curricula and limited access to quality learning materials, AI-driven education tools — such as intelligent tutoring systems, adaptive learning platforms and language translation technologies — can play a transformative role.

In Africa, for instance, where deep-rooted educational inequalities persist, AI offers a powerful tool to bridge gaps, democratize knowledge and chart a more equitable digital future. But to unlock this promise, access must come first.

Africa's digital divide remains a structural barrier. As of 2023, only about 37 percent of Africans were using the internet, leaving nearly 60 percent offline. Even basic electricity access is unreliable for large segments of the population, with only around 43 percent enjoying consistent power — an essential prerequisite for digital learning. Moreover, Africa accounts for less than 1 percent of global data center capacity, despite being home to 18 percent of the world's population. In such a context, digital infrastructure is not just a technical need — it is a foundation for educational equity.

Over the past decade, China has emerged as a key partner in addressing this gap. Through initiatives such as the Digital Silk Road and the Forum on China-Africa Cooperation, China has invested in fiber-optic networks, cloud data centers, 5G deployment and satellite connectivity across the continent. In 2024 alone, China committed $29.2 billion to projects in Africa, with digital and technological infrastructure accounting for 14.3 percent of that total. These investments lay critical groundwork for expanding AI-enabled education tools across borders and communities.

But infrastructure, while necessary, is not sufficient. There is the need to embed AI in education for broader reforms, such as teacher training, building localized curricula, providing inclusive language options and boosting ethical data governance. The tools must reflect African realities, by supporting local languages, respecting cultural contexts and protecting the privacy of learners. Equally, these tools must be jointly developed with African educators, students and technologists, ensuring they are not just usable, but relevant and empowering.

This is where South-South cooperation can make a structural difference. Unlike traditional donor-recipient models that often impose external solutions, South-South partnerships emphasize mutual learning, co-creation and context sensitivity. The United Nations Office for South-South Cooperation advocates this model as a "catalyst and enabler" of digital transformation — highlighting the value of peer-to-peer learning, locally adapted solutions, and shared knowledge ecosystems.

Through such partnerships, African institutions can collaborate with Chinese universities, Southeast Asian AI labs and Global South ed-tech innovators to develop educational technologies that meet Africa's needs. Shared innovation, rather than one-size-fits-all solutions, must be the goal. This also includes advancing inclusive governance frameworks for AI that safeguard the rights and agency of African learners and educators.

Importantly, AI education should not be limited to passive consumption. With nearly 60 percent of its population being under the age of 25, Africa has the world's youngest population — and potentially, its largest future AI talent base. Therefore, African youths must be equipped not only to use AI technologies, but to build and govern them. This demands long-term investment in digital and AI literacy — from primary school to university — fostering skills in coding, data science and responsible innovation.

Encouragingly, countries such as Rwanda have introduced AI and robotics in secondary education, and Ghana is drafting a national AI strategy with a strong educational component. In support of such efforts, China has pledged to provide training to 40,000 African teachers over a three-year period starting in 2024 — a critical step toward building the human capital needed to support AI literacy across the continent.

Looking ahead, AI education must be understood not merely as a technological advancement, but as a fundamental rights-based imperative. Exclusion from AI literacy today could mean exclusion from economic opportunity tomorrow. If AI is truly to fulfill its promise of democratizing access to knowledge, it must begin by reaching those who have historically been left behind — and that journey begins in Africa.
